Thanks for any info you can provide. My family is planning to book two reservations this December. For the first reservation which is 10 days at Pop Century, we want to add the dining plan package to our reservation. Then, we want to add a separate 3 night reservation at the Polynesian following our 10 days at Pop. We will not be adding the dining package to this 3 day reservation. So our plan would be as follows:
10 days at Pop Century + dining plan
3 days at Poly - no dining plan.

I know that the dining plan doesn't expire until midnight of the day you check out. However, we will be checking IN to a different hotel on that same day. Will this different reservation impact our ability to continue using the dining plan on that day? I may be overthinking this too much. I was just hoping to have a nice dinner at Kona Cafe on our last day of dining. TIA!! :goodvibes
 
Your DDP credits will be on your POP room keys. When you check in at Poly, you'll get a new set of room keys. Your credits don't transfer to the new card, so just keep your old room keys and use those to enjoy your dinner at Kona. If you have any snack or CS credits remaining, you could use those at the Poly, too. Have fun!
